Objective

Purpose of the course:
During the internship, you will do logistics tasks and see how the things you learned in school are implemented in practice. You will network with professionals in the field, and gain valuable work experience for the future.

Course competencies:
The curriculum competencies promoted in the course are the application of technology to practice, as well as communication and teamwork.

Learning outcomes of the course:
The theme of the second internship is the logistics industry and job tasks. The goal is to identify job opportunities and activities in the field, to learn job tasks in practice, and to be able to interact constructively with members of the work community.

Content

Content:
Completing an internship involves a period of work at the workplace and reporting learning objectives to the school. The duration of the internship must be at least 7 calendar weeks, when it is a full-time job. If it is a part-time job, the duration of the internship is correspondingly longer. All logistics jobs are broadly accepted for the internship and there are no specific requirements for the company.

Location and time

After the second year of study. If the student has passed the previous internship period 1 with previous work experience, this can be completed after the first year of study.

Teaching methods

Logistics tasks performed at the workplace, as well as reporting and self-evaluation.

Employer connections

Performed at the workplace.

Exam schedules

No exam.

Student workload

One credit point means an average of 27 hours of work, i.e. a total of 270 hours of implementation.

Assessment criteria, approved/failed

The completed practical training report will be evaluated on a pass/fail scale. The approved report must comply with the reporting guidelines.

Qualifications

Practical training 1 completed and one year of logistics studies.
